Step 2: Demolition and Preparation

Once we have a clear plan in place, our team will begin the demolition process, removing the damaged flooring and preparing the area for replacement. This includes removing any affected materials, cleaning the subfloor, and ensuring the area is dry and ready for new flooring.

Warning Signs You Need Flooring Replacement After Water Damage

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and further damage. Here are some common signs that show you need flooring replacement after water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

When water damage occurs, it can leave behind a musty smell that’s hard to get rid of. If you notice a persistent odor, it’s likely a sign that your flooring has absorbed moisture, leading to mold and mildew growth. Don’t ignore this sign, call us today to assess the damage and recommend the best course of action.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. If you notice this sign, it’s essential to act fast to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.

Discoloration or Stains

Water damage can cause discoloration or stains on your flooring, which can be difficult to remove. If you notice this sign, it’s likely a sign that your flooring has been compromised, and it’s time to consider replacement.

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ost In Kingsland, GA

The cost of flooring replacement after water damage var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Kingsland, GA. Here are some estimated costs for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small water spill on hardwood floor $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
Major flood in your home $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
Water damage to a single room $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
Water damage to multiple rooms or floors $5,000 – $20,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
Water damage to a commercial property $10,000 – $50,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
